The underlying inspiration for buying Switchboard Upgrades extends far beyond mere convenience, anchoring itself Switchboard Upgrades deeply in modern fire avoidance and individual safety standards. Legacy systems do not have contemporary Residual Current Gadgets, which serve as instantaneous lifesavers by identifying microscopic imbalances in electrical currents. These wise switches cut off power within milliseconds of spotting a fault, avoiding serious electrical shocks and mitigating the danger of structural fires caused by weakening, decades-old circuitry.
